How can businesses strike a balance between utilizing customer data to personalize their loyalty programs and respecting their customers' privacy concerns in today's data-driven economy?

Loyalty Programs
Businesses can strike a balance by being transparent about how they collect and use customer data, obtaining explicit consent before using it for personalization, and allowing customers to opt out if they choose. They can also prioritize data security measures to protect customer information and comply with data privacy regulations. Additionally, businesses can offer incentives or rewards for customers who are willing to share their data, creating a mutually beneficial relationship based on trust and value.
